Influencer marketing is no longer one-size-fits-all.

Brands today can choose between macro, micro, and nano influencers depending on their goals, budget, and audience. But many marketers still get confused about which category actually delivers better results.

The truth is simple. Each type of influencer serves a different purpose.

If you understand the difference clearly, your campaigns become sharper and more cost-effective.

Let us break it down.

What Are Macro Influencers?

Macro influencers typically have 100,000 to 1 million followers.

These creators have large audiences and strong visibility. Many of them are well-known content creators, public personalities, or niche experts with significant reach.

What they offer:

Macro influencers are useful when your goal is awareness. If you are launching a new product or entering a new market, their reach can help you generate quick attention.

But engagement rates may be lower compared to smaller influencers. And their fees are higher.

So they work best for brands that want scale.

What Are Micro Influencers?

Micro influencers usually have 10,000 to 100,000 followers.

This category has become very popular in recent years.

Why? Because they often have stronger engagement rates. Their audiences trust them more. And their communities feel personal and interactive.

What they offer:

If your brand operates in a specific category like skincare, fitness, finance, or regional markets, micro influencers can deliver focused results.

They are ideal for performance-driven campaigns where engagement matters more than pure reach.

What Are Nano Influencers?

Nano influencers generally have 1,000 to 10,000 followers.

At first glance, this may seem small. But their power lies in intimacy.

These creators often influence friends, family, and local communities. Their recommendations feel personal rather than promotional.

What they offer:

Nano influencers are useful for regional campaigns, local store promotions, and community-driven marketing.

But managing many nano influencers requires structured coordination.

Which Type of Influencer Should a Brand Choose?

This depends entirely on your campaign goal.

Sometimes, the best strategy is a mix.

Many brands combine macro influencers for awareness and micro or nano influencers for engagement and conversion. This layered approach balances reach and performance.

The key is alignment. Do not choose based on follower count alone. Choose based on audience relevance and campaign objective.
